Not Ranked. Helpful AND tactful post? : 0 I've have been looking on line lately and i've decided that i would like to adopt a rabbit. My question is what should i expect when trying to adopt? Do i go and meet the rabbit and if they like me do i get to take her home? Will they come to my house and check things out first before i can take her home? Also if someone could help me find a female holland lop to adopt that would be great. I live in Havelock,NC 28532 Hope someone can help, Thanks so much |

It really depends on the shelter. Some shelters, you can just walk in, signs some papers, and walk out with a rabbit. Other shelters are more stringent. Depending on the shelter, they could do home checks, vet checks, etc. Good luck! |

I adopted my rabbit from the Cape Fear Rabbit Society in NC. I am in SC so she did not do a home check, however I did have to send her a picture of my cage. The lady that runs it is really nice and will let you come to her home and check out the rabbits and she will let you spend time with them and see how you interact. There is an adoption agreement and I think there is a short adoption application. Here is the link to her page Cape Fear House Rabbit Society, Adoptable Rabbits. |
